# 引言
在当今数字化时代,数据如同血液一般滋养着每一个信息系统。而在这条信息的“血管”中,管道隔离阀与动态数组扩容扮演着至关重要的角色。它们不仅在数据传输与存储中发挥着独特的作用,更是现代信息技术领域中不可或缺的基石。本文将深入探讨这两个概念,揭示它们在实际应用中的奥秘,以及它们如何共同构建起高效、安全的数据处理体系。
# 管道隔离阀:数据传输的“守门员”
## 什么是管道隔离阀?
管道隔离阀,顾名思义,是一种用于控制和管理数据流的设备。它在数据传输过程中扮演着“守门员”的角色,确保数据能够按照预定的路径安全、高效地流动。在计算机网络中,管道隔离阀通常指的是网络设备中的防火墙、路由器等,它们通过设置规则来过滤和控制数据包的进出。
## 管道隔离阀的工作原理
管道隔离阀的核心功能在于过滤和控制数据流。它通过设置一系列规则,如访问控制列表(ACL)、安全策略等,来决定哪些数据包可以进入或离开网络。这些规则可以根据不同的需求进行定制,从而实现对数据传输的精细化管理。例如,在企业网络中,管道隔离阀可以阻止恶意软件和未经授权的数据访问,保护内部系统的安全。
## 管道隔离阀的应用场景
管道隔离阀广泛应用于各种网络环境中,包括企业内部网络、数据中心、公共互联网等。在企业内部网络中,管道隔离阀可以防止内部敏感信息泄露到外部网络;在数据中心中,它可以确保不同服务器之间的通信安全;在公共互联网中,它可以有效抵御来自外部的攻击,保护用户的数据安全。
## 管道隔离阀的优势
管道隔离阀的优势在于其强大的过滤和控制能力。它能够根据不同的需求设置灵活的规则,从而实现对数据传输的精细化管理。此外,管道隔离阀还具有高度的可扩展性和灵活性,可以根据网络环境的变化进行调整和优化。这些特点使得管道隔离阀成为现代网络环境中不可或缺的安全保障。
# 动态数组扩容:数据存储的“魔术师”
## 什么是动态数组扩容?
动态数组扩容是指在程序运行过程中,根据实际需要自动调整数组大小的技术。它允许数组在存储空间不足时自动扩展,从而避免因数组溢出而导致的程序崩溃。动态数组扩容是现代编程语言中常用的一种技术,广泛应用于各种应用场景中。
## 动态数组扩容的工作原理
动态数组扩容的核心在于其自动调整机制。当数组中的元素数量超过当前分配的存储空间时,程序会自动检测并重新分配更大的存储空间,以容纳更多的元素。这一过程通常通过复制原有数据到新分配的空间中完成。动态数组扩容不仅提高了程序的灵活性,还大大减少了因数组溢出而导致的错误。
## 动态数组扩容的应用场景
动态数组扩容广泛应用于各种编程场景中,包括数据处理、算法实现、数据库管理等。在数据处理中,动态数组扩容可以确保程序能够高效地处理大量数据;在算法实现中,它可以提高算法的执行效率;在数据库管理中,它可以确保数据库能够灵活地扩展以满足不断增长的数据需求。
## 动态数组扩容的优势
动态数组扩容的优势在于其灵活性和高效性。它能够根据实际需要自动调整数组大小,从而避免因数组溢出而导致的错误。此外,动态数组扩容还具有较高的性能,能够在不影响程序运行效率的情况下实现数据的动态管理。这些特点使得动态数组扩容成为现代编程中不可或缺的技术手段。
# 管道隔离阀与动态数组扩容的关联
## 数据传输与存储的桥梁
管道隔离阀与动态数组扩容看似毫不相关,实则在数据传输与存储中扮演着至关重要的角色。管道隔离阀确保数据能够安全、高效地传输,而动态数组扩容则保证数据能够灵活、高效地存储。两者共同构建起一个高效、安全的数据处理体系,为现代信息技术的发展提供了坚实的基础。
## 安全与效率的平衡
管道隔离阀通过设置规则来过滤和控制数据流,确保数据传输的安全性;而动态数组扩容则通过自动调整数组大小来提高数据存储的效率。两者在安全与效率之间找到了完美的平衡点,使得数据处理过程更加高效、可靠。
## 灵活性与可扩展性的结合
管道隔离阀可以根据不同的需求设置灵活的规则,实现对数据传输的精细化管理;而动态数组扩容则能够根据实际需要自动调整数组大小,提高数据存储的灵活性。两者在灵活性与可扩展性方面实现了完美的结合,使得数据处理过程更加灵活、可扩展。
# 结语
管道隔离阀与动态数组扩容虽然看似毫不相关,但它们在数据传输与存储中发挥着至关重要的作用。通过深入探讨这两个概念,我们不仅能够更好地理解它们在实际应用中的奥秘,还能够认识到它们在现代信息技术领域中的重要地位。未来,随着技术的不断发展和创新,管道隔离阀与动态数组扩容将继续发挥更大的作用,为数据处理过程带来更多的便利和高效。
通过本文的探讨,我们希望能够激发读者对这两个概念的兴趣,并进一步探索它们在实际应用中的更多可能性。